Know the Risks: Common Scams, Bots, and Red Flags

Hook up sites can expose users to several threats: romance scams, requests for money, catfishing, fake accounts, bots, and phishing. Scammers use fast trust, pressure, and fake urgency to cause emotional and financial harm. Early detection stops loss of money and time. Use the red-flag checklist below when a profile or conversation seems off.

Types of Scams and How They Operate

Advance-fee scams ask for payment before a promise is fulfilled. Fake emergency scams claim sudden trouble and request cash. Account takeovers try to access profiles or linked email. Wallet and payment scams push gift cards, transfers, or crypto. Key signals include sudden requests for money, inconsistent story details, mismatched account names, and redirected contact off the platform.

How to Spot Fake Profiles and Bots

Watch for profile mismatches, stock or overly polished photos, minimal profile text, repetitive messages, odd active hours, and refusal to show live video. Quick checks: run a reverse-image search, search usernames on other sites, check message style for copy-paste patterns, and ask for on-camera verification.

Psychological Tricks Scammers Use

Scammers use strong flattery, pressure to move off-platform, quick declarations of strong feelings, and sob stories to shorten trust. Respond with time, ask for simple live proof, and pause when pushed. If needed, stop the chat and block. Use short stalling choices like asking for more time, requesting platform verification, or offering to continue later if uncomfortable.

Secure Your Account: Profile, Photos, and Privacy Settings

Create a profile that attracts matches without revealing home, work, or routine details. Keep account hygiene up to date with strong passwords, two-factor authentication, and careful email use. Limit location sharing and remove metadata from photos.

Writing a Privacy-First Bio and Managing Personal Details

Do not include full name, workplace, home address, weekly routine, or places visited often. Share interests, short personality notes, and date preferences. Keep statements general and avoid linking to other social accounts until trust is built.

Photo Safety: How to Share Images Securely

Pick photos that do not show identifying landmarks, license plates, or workplace logos. Crop or blur backgrounds, remove location metadata, and use private photo albums when possible. Run a reverse-image search to check if images appear elsewhere.

Account Security: Passwords, 2FA, and Verification Tools

Create unique passwords and enable two-factor authentication. Use platform verification badges when offered and routinely check connected apps and sessions. If an account looks compromised, change passwords, log out other sessions, and report to support immediately.

Communicate Smart: Messages, Payments, Video Verification, and Meeting Prep

Keep contact on the app until trust is clear. Never send money, gift codes, or crypto. Use live video or voice checks to confirm identity before meeting. Plan meetings with safety in mind.

What to Share — and When — in Conversations

Pace personal details. Refuse requests to move to private messaging or phone too soon. Keep sensitive data off public profiles. Redirect attempts to move off-platform back to the site’s chat or verification tools.

Avoiding Financial and Gift Scams

Any request for money is a red flag. Politely refuse, document the request, block the user, and report to site support. Save screenshots and transaction records if money was sent.

Video and Voice Verification: Safer Ways to Confirm Identity

Ask for a short live video or voice call with a simple prompt. Look for natural timing and matching face and voice. Declined or edited-feeling media are warning signs. Prefer the site’s built-in verification badge when available.

Preparing for an In-Person Meet: Pre-Meet Checklist

  • Tell a friend approximate time and place.
  • Share live location for check-in.
  • Choose a public, well-lit venue and plan independent transport.
  • Set a clear exit plan and time limit.
  • Carry a charged phone and safety app or hotline info.

Ready-to-Use Checklists: Profile, Pre-Meet, and Red Flags

  • Profile review: no full name, no workplace, clear photos without location data, verification enabled.
  • Pre-meet: friend notified, public venue, transport plan, charged phone.
  • Red-flag rapid-scan: asks for money, avoids video, pushes off-platform, inconsistent details.

Reporting, Blocking, and Post-Incident Steps
